Telematics technology, which utilizes Global Positioning System (GPS) for tracking and monitoring industrial equipment, is increasingly being integrated into carry deck cranes. This technology offers significant benefits to equipment owners and fleet managers, including enhanced operational efficiency and profitability. Carry deck crane manufacturers have responded to market demand by incorporating telematics hardware into their product offerings. This advanced technology enables real-time monitoring of critical data, such as machine location, component usage, and fault codes. While cost is always a consideration, the advantages of telematics technology, including improved asset utilization and increased productivity, are compelling reasons for businesses to invest in this technology. The data generated from telematics systems can be analyzed to optimize operations, reduce downtime, and ultimately boost profits.
